#!/usr/bin/env node
/**
* C2 Commander Bootstrap CLI — One-time initialization.
*
* This script is the ONLY way to create a COMMANDER account.
* It runs exclusively on the server machine, never via HTTP.
* Replicates client-side WebCrypto key derivation using Node native crypto.
*
* Usage: node setup.js --init-commander
*/
'use strict';
const readline = require('readline');
const {
pbkdf2,
createCipheriv,
generateKeyPairSync,
randomBytes,
scrypt,
} = require('crypto');
const sqlite3 = require('sqlite3').verbose();
const path = require('path');
const fs = require('fs');
require('dotenv').config();
// ─── Constants — must mirror app.js exactly ───────────────────────────────────
const DOMAIN = process.env.CLOUDFLARE_DOMAIN ?? 'c2.secure.forum';
const PBKDF2_ITERATIONS = 600_000;
const PBKDF2_KEY_LEN = 32; // bytes → 256-bit keys
const SCRYPT_PARAMS = { N: 131072, r: 8, p: 1, maxmem: 256 * 1024 * 1024 };
const SCRYPT_KEY_LEN = 64;
const HASH_VERSION = 'v2';
// ─── Guard ────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────
const flag = process.argv[2];
if (flag !== '--init-commander') {
console.error('Usage: node setup.js --init-commander');
process.exit(1);
}
// ─── Database ─────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────
const dataDir = path.join(__dirname, 'data');
if (!fs.existsSync(dataDir)) fs.mkdirSync(dataDir, { recursive: true });
const db = new sqlite3.Database(path.join(dataDir, 'database.sqlite'), (err) => {
if (err) { console.error('[FATAL] DB:', err.message); process.exit(1); }
});
db.run('PRAGMA foreign_keys=ON');
db.run(`
CREATE TABLE IF NOT EXISTS users (
codename TEXT PRIMARY KEY,
password_hash TEXT NOT NULL,
public_key_spki TEXT NOT NULL,
encrypted_private_key TEXT,
role TEXT NOT NULL DEFAULT 'AGENT',
bio TEXT NOT NULL DEFAULT 'INITIALIZED AGENT NODE.',
joined_date TEXT NOT NULL
)
`);
// ─── Interactive CLI ──────────────────────────────────────────────────────────
const IS_TTY = process.stdin.isTTY === true;
/**
* On non-TTY environments (piped input), readline's rl.question() races with
* the piped data causing premature EOF ("readline was closed").
* Solution: when piped, read ALL lines up front, then serve them sequentially.
*/
const inputQueue = [];
/**
* Populate inputQueue by reading all piped lines before interaction begins.
* Returns a promise that resolves when stdin is fully buffered.
*/
let rl;
const bufferPipedInput = () =>
new Promise((resolve) => {
if (IS_TTY) {
rl = readline.createInterface({ input: process.stdin, output: process.stdout });
return resolve();
}
rl = readline.createInterface({ input: process.stdin });
rl.on('line', (line) => inputQueue.push(line));
rl.on('close', resolve);
});
const ask = (prompt) => {
process.stdout.write(prompt);
if (!IS_TTY) {
const line = inputQueue.shift() ?? '';
process.stdout.write(`${line}\n`);
return Promise.resolve(line);
}
return new Promise((res) => rl.question('', res));
};
/**
* Reads a secret from stdin.
* TTY: masks characters with '*'.
* Non-TTY: reads the next pre-buffered line.
*/
const askSecret = (prompt) => {
process.stdout.write(prompt);
if (!IS_TTY) {
const line = inputQueue.shift() ?? '';
process.stdout.write('**hidden**\n');
return Promise.resolve(line);
}
return new Promise((resolve) => {
rl.pause();
const stdin = process.stdin;
stdin.setRawMode(true);
stdin.resume();
stdin.setEncoding('utf8');
let buffer = '';
const handler = (char) => {
if (char === '\n' || char === '\r' || char === '\u0004') {
stdin.setRawMode(false);
stdin.removeListener('data', handler);
stdin.pause();
process.stdout.write('\n');
rl.resume();
resolve(buffer);
} else if (char === '\u0003') {
process.exit(0);
} else if (char === '\u007f') {
if (buffer.length > 0) {
buffer = buffer.slice(0, -1);
process.stdout.write('\b \b');
}
} else {
buffer += char;
process.stdout.write('*');
}
};
stdin.on('data', handler);
});
};
// ─── Crypto — mirrors WebCrypto deriveKeys() exactly ─────────────────────────
const pbkdf2Async = (password, salt, iterations, keyLen) =>
new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
pbkdf2(password, salt, iterations, keyLen, 'sha256', (err, dk) => {
if (err) reject(err); else resolve(dk);
});
});
const scryptAsync = (password, salt) =>
new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
const rawSalt = randomBytes(32).toString('hex');
scrypt(password, rawSalt, SCRYPT_KEY_LEN, SCRYPT_PARAMS, (err, dk) => {
if (err) return reject(err);
resolve(`${HASH_VERSION}:${rawSalt}:${dk.toString('hex')}`);
});
});
/**
* Derives authKey and aesKeyBuf using PBKDF2-SHA256.
* Salt format MUST match public/app.js CryptoEngine.deriveKeys() exactly:
* "${DOMAIN}:${codename.toLowerCase()}:auth:v2"
* "${DOMAIN}:${codename.toLowerCase()}:enc:v2"
*/
async function deriveKeys(passphrase, codename) {
const name = codename.toLowerCase();
const authSalt = `${DOMAIN}:${name}:auth:v2`;
const encSalt = `${DOMAIN}:${name}:enc:v2`;
const [authBuf, aesBuf] = await Promise.all([
pbkdf2Async(passphrase, authSalt, PBKDF2_ITERATIONS, PBKDF2_KEY_LEN),
pbkdf2Async(passphrase, encSalt, PBKDF2_ITERATIONS, PBKDF2_KEY_LEN),
]);
return {
authKey: authBuf.toString('hex'),
aesKeyBuf: aesBuf,
};
}
/**
* Generates an ECDSA P-256 keypair using Node's native crypto.
*/
function generateKeyPair() {
const { privateKey, publicKey } = generateKeyPairSync('ec', { namedCurve: 'prime256v1' });
return {
publicKeySPKI: publicKey.export({ type: 'spki', format: 'der' }).toString('base64'),
privateKeyPKCS8: privateKey.export({ type: 'pkcs8', format: 'der' }),
};
}
/**
* Encrypts the PKCS8 private key DER buffer with AES-256-GCM.
* Output format MUST match WebCrypto encryptPrivateKey() output:
* "<iv-base64>:<ciphertext+authTag-base64>"
* WebCrypto appends the 16-byte GCM auth tag to the ciphertext automatically.
*/
function encryptPrivateKey(privateKeyPKCS8, aesKeyBuf) {
const iv = randomBytes(12); // 96-bit IV for AES-GCM
const cipher = createCipheriv('aes-256-gcm', aesKeyBuf, iv);
const encrypted = Buffer.concat([cipher.update(privateKeyPKCS8), cipher.final()]);
const authTag = cipher.getAuthTag(); // 16 bytes, appended to match WebCrypto
return `${iv.toString('base64')}:${Buffer.concat([encrypted, authTag]).toString('base64')}`;
}
// ─── Bootstrap Flow ───────────────────────────────────────────────────────────
async function initCommander() {
await bufferPipedInput();
console.log('\n╔══════════════════════════════════════════╗');
console.log('║ C2 — COMMANDER BOOTSTRAP CLI (v2) ║');
console.log('╚══════════════════════════════════════════╝\n');
// Idempotency guard — abort if commander already exists
const existing = await new Promise((resolve) => {
db.get("SELECT codename FROM users WHERE role = 'COMMANDER'", [], (err, row) => resolve(row ?? null));
});
if (existing) {
console.error(`[ABORT] Commander "${existing.codename}" is already initialized.`);
console.error('[ABORT] To reinitialize: manually DELETE the record from data/database.sqlite, then re-run.');
if (IS_TTY) rl.close();
db.close(); process.exit(1);
}
console.log('[!] This runs ONCE. No UI registration of COMMANDER is possible after this.\n');
const rawCodename = (await ask('Commander codename [Noir]: ')).trim();
const codename = rawCodename || 'Noir';
const passphrase = await askSecret('Passphrase (hidden input): ');
if (passphrase.length < 8) {
console.error('\n[ERROR] Passphrase must be at least 8 characters.');
if (IS_TTY) rl.close();
db.close(); process.exit(1);
}
const confirm = await askSecret('Confirm passphrase (hidden input): ');
if (passphrase !== confirm) {
console.error('\n[ERROR] Passphrases do not match.');
if (IS_TTY) rl.close();
db.close(); process.exit(1);
}
if (IS_TTY) rl.close();
console.log('\n[INFO] Deriving cryptographic material — please wait (~5–10 s)...');
const { authKey, aesKeyBuf } = await deriveKeys(passphrase, codename);
const { publicKeySPKI, privateKeyPKCS8 } = generateKeyPair();
const encryptedPrivateKey = encryptPrivateKey(privateKeyPKCS8, aesKeyBuf);
const passwordHash = await scryptAsync(authKey);
const joinedDate = new Date().toISOString().substring(0, 10);
await new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
db.run(
`INSERT INTO users
(codename, password_hash, public_key_spki, encrypted_private_key, role, status, bio, joined_date)
VALUES (?, ?, ?, ?, 'COMMANDER', 'ACTIVE', 'COMMANDER NODE INITIALIZED.', ?)`,
[codename, passwordHash, publicKeySPKI, encryptedPrivateKey, joinedDate],
(err) => { if (err) reject(err); else resolve(); }
);
});
console.log(`\n[OK] Commander "${codename}" initialized successfully.`);
console.log('[OK] Log in from the forum UI with your passphrase.');
console.log('[OK] Private key stored encrypted (AES-256-GCM, PBKDF2-600k).\n');
db.close();
}
initCommander().catch((err) => {
console.error('[FATAL]', err.message);
db.close();
process.exit(1);
});
